Lawsuit over former NFL coach’s death targets safety conditions on Dougherty Road

The family of late NFL coach Greg Knapp is seeking damages in court following his death nearly three years ago after being struck by a vehicle while bicycling in San Ramon, with the next court date in the civil case set for this week.

Pleasanton Police Chief Swing stepping down next month

Pleasanton’s Police Chief David Swing will be leaving the department soon after having accepted an executive director position at the East Bay Regional Communications System Authority, according to a press release from the city on Friday.
